Reflection Journal #3

What are some fears and/or concerns and/or challenges I have about teaching on-line? What

are some excitements and/or aha-moments I have had about teaching on-line?

After watching a couple of zoom classes some of my biggest concerns or fears would be

not being able to keep the student’s attention as well as not being able to effectively teach

them. I feel like children work best when they are in an environment that supports and creating

the best possible learning outcomes. Unfortunately, in our homes, there are a lot of distractions

for the children to get carried away with. Today in our zoom meeting, I noticed that students

were jumping around or more focused on their siblings then they were on the lesson. I feel like

if I couldn’t keep their attention during the zoom meeting, would they be grasping the concept

of the lesson? These are the questions and concerns I have been trying to resolve since starting

the online teaching. On the other hand, I have seen how excited the students have gotten to

see their friends and learn while still being at home. I do understand that online teaching can be

difficult at times, but I hope to find ways to keep the student’s attention as much as possible.
